Weather in September

The first month of the spring, September, is a refreshing month in Kiwitea, New Zealand, with temperature in the range of an average low of 4.8°C (40.6°F) and an average high of 13.2°C (55.8°F).

Temperature

The average high-temperature during September registers at a moderate 13.2°C (55.8°F), closely corresponding to the preceding month. Kiwitea in September experiences a low-temperature average of 4.8°C (40.6°F).

Humidity

In Kiwitea, the average relative humidity in September is 85%.

Rainfall

In September, the rain falls for 14.6 days. Throughout September, 42mm (1.65")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Kiwitea, there are 175.5 rainfall days, and 563mm (22.17")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through July, September through December are months without snowfall.

Daylight

In Kiwitea, the average length of the day in September is 11h and 49min.
On the first day of September in Kiwitea, sunrise is at 6:40 am and sunset at 5:53 pm NZST.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:52 am and sunset at 7:21 pm NZDT.
Note: On Sunday, 29. September 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from NZST to NZD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, 06. April 2025, at 3: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from NZDT to NZST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in September in Kiwitea is 6.6h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in September is 3. A UV Index reading of 3 to 5 represents a moderate thre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
